What is a Mohs Surgery Assistant?

Mohs Surgery Assistants are specialized medical professionals who support dermatologists during Mohs micrographic surgery, a precise technique for treating skin cancer. Their responsibilities include preparing surgical instruments, assisting with tissue processing, maintaining a sterile environment, and providing patient care before, during, and after the procedure. They may also handle administrative tasks, such as scheduling and record-keeping, to ensure the smooth operation of the surgical practice. Their expertise helps ensure the procedure is efficient and successful, contributing to optimal patient out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Mohs Surgery Assistant?

To thrive as a Mohs Surgery Assistant, you need a solid background in medical assisting, sterile technique, and histology, usually supported by a medical assistant certification or relevant experience. Familiarity with surgical instruments, cryostats, pathology lab equipment, and electronic medical record (EMR) systems is typically required.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ication are essential soft skills for this role. These abilities are crucial to ensure safe, efficient surgical procedures and accurate tissue processing in high-pressure dermatologic settings.

What are some common challenges faced by Mohs Surgery Assistants in a clinical setting?

Mohs Surgery Assistants often encounter challenges such as managing a fast-paced workflow while maintaining high attention to detail during tissue processing and documentation. They must also balance direct patient care with the technical tasks of preparing specimens and assisting the surgeon, all while ensuring strict adherence to sterile techniques. Additionally, effective communication and coordination with the surgical team are essential, as they often need to anticipate the surgeon’s needs and respond quickly to changes during procedures.

What is the difference between Mohs Surgery Assistant vs Surgical Technologist?

AspectMohs Surgery AssistantSurgical Technologist
CredentialsCertified or trained in dermatology proceduresCertified or registered in surgical technology
Work EnvironmentDermatology clinics, Mohs surgery centersHospitals, surgical centers, clinics
Industry UsageSpecialized in dermatologic and Mohs proceduresGeneral surgical settings across specialties
Job FocusAssisting with Mohs surgery, patient prep, instrument handlingPreparing operating rooms, passing instruments, assisting during surgeries

While both roles support surgical procedures, Mohs Surgery Assistants specialize in dermatologic and Mohs-specific procedures, focusing on patient prep and assisting during skin cancer surgeries. Surgical Technologists have a broader scope across various surgical fields, preparing operating rooms and assisting in multiple types of surgeries. The roles overlap in certification and work environment but differ in specialization and daily responsibilities.

Is it hard to become a Mohs Surgery Assistant?

Becoming a Mohs Surgery Assistant typically requires a high school diploma or equivalent, along with relevant experience or training in medical assisting or dermatology. The role involves learning specific procedures and tools used in Mohs surgery, and some positions may require certification or on-the-job training, but it is generally accessible with the right background and skills. The difficulty varies depending on individual experience and the employer's requirements.
